Review: Wallflower - Cookie O'Gorman - March 2021


This book had captured my attention as I love those stories of #nerd meets and falls in love with a #jock as it can show that opposites truly do exist and also that you can never judge a person by their looks and that under a plain girl will be the "forever" one and that under pretty looks are "easy girls". For Viola, she inherited her mum's nerdiness rather than her dad's athletic ability and looks. Viola is her mother's daughter and would rather spend her time reading and hanging out with the animals at the shelter. In this book, we see the bullies call Viola "dog girl", I have to admit I didn't like this as it got me a bit confused as I had just last week read a book called "Dog Girl" which was also about an #nerd who worked at a dog shelter and this is also what the bullies called her and this felt too close for my comfort especially also since both books are published by the same company and promoted via the same tour company. Back to the story after my little gripe, we have Viola who learns her dad has promised soccer star Dare Frost - that Viola will drive him to and from school. Soon the pair start spending time together but when Viola learns her dad asked Dare to be her friend - she puts on her Slytherin hat and decides to get revenge on her dad by fake dating Dare and then the rest is history as we all know what happens with fake romances. As this book is a YA high school romance and published by Swoon Romance, it is also a clean romance and suitable for girls aged 12 - 16+.
